The ideas for private driveway and hydra happened on the same day, within the span of my lunch hour. While at a stoplight, I looked to my left and saw a bird perched on a post and immediately thought it would make an interesting drawing. Then, while in the pet store I stopped to look at the cats they had for adoption. In one cage was a trio of black cats – abandoned by their owner, the card said. Heartbreaking. They were in a lower cage and were sitting together towards the back. I couldn’t see anything but three sets of green eyes staring back at me, like a feline Hydra. Again, a drawing .
I got back to the office and did these really quick sketches to preserve the ideas. Sometimes, no matter how good they might be, I lose drawing concepts in the mental overload of the every day. Note-taking has become essential.
